SIKESTON -- A Sikeston teen has been charged with murder after a death early Saturday morning on Westview Street.
Brianna M. Branson, 17, of Miner, has been charged with second degree murder, tampering with evidence, leaving the scene and minor in possession of alcohol after events that led to the death Kendra Nichole Gray, 18, of Sikeston.
According to the Sikeston Department of Public Safety, a call came in just before 6 a.m. Saturday to what was initially described as a "motor vehicle accident." It was said a woman was struck by a vehicle in the 900 block of Westview Street.
When emergency units arrived on the scene, Gray was found lying dead in front of 908 Westview.
Officers with DPS began investigating but soon had information that the act may have been intentional.
According to a DPS release, an underage party was in progress at the home of 908 Westview that started on Friday evening and continued until the incident took place. Both Branson and Gray were at the party and had previous problems between each other.
Early Saturday an argument and attempted assault broke out inside the home between the two women. The fight continued outside in the front yard to a point when Branson tried to leave in her vehicle.
Based on the facts available to DPS officers, while Branson tried to leave she used her vehicle to scare or intimidate Gray by driving directly at her. Gray, who was standing in the road, was struck shortly after Branson took off in her vehicle. Branson then continued in her truck and left the scene, returning after a short period of time. Police believe this is when Branson disposed of alcohol that she brought to the party.
Scott County Prosecutor Paul Boyd charged Branson on Saturday evening and she is currently in custody at the Scott County Jail where she was given a $150,000 cash only bond.
